Weber's Tangy Barbecue Sauce Recipe
(From: Weber's Big Book of Grilling. This classic is great on pork ribs, chicken and beef)
- Makes about 11/3 cups (325 mL)
- 2 tablespoons (25 mL) unsalted butter
- 1/2 cup (125 mL) finely chopped celery
- 3 tablespoons (50 mL) finely chopped yellow onion
- 1 cup (250 mL) ketchup
- 2 tablespoons (25 mL) l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ons (25 mL) sugar
- 2 tablespoons (25 mL) cider vinegar
- 1 tablespoon (15 mL) Worcestershire sauce
- 1 teaspoon (5 mL) dry mustard
- Freshly ground black pepper, to taste
- In a medium saucepan over medium-high heat, melt butter. Add celery and onion and cook 2 to 3 minutes, stirring occasionally.
- Add remaining ingredients and whisk together. Bring to a boil, reduce heat, cover and simmer 15 minutes.
- Transfer to a bowl, cover with plastic food wrap and refrigerate until needed.
